It's critical you get you and your 7 yr old daughter away from him. Do NOT tell him you're thinking about leaving. If you can arrange for your family to come and get you and your daughter while he is at work, that would be your best bet. Decide what to take with the assumption that you will never be back again. Things aren't important. You and your daughter are.
Then you can contact their local women's shelter and an attorney to make sure you all stay safe.
Otherwise, contact your local women's shelter and ask for help leaving. It is imperative that you make a SAFE plan to leave. Leaving is THE most dangerous time for you and your daughter. He's already shown you that he has no qualms about taking your 7 yr old away from you.
Do NOT tell him you want a divorce. Do NOT threaten to kick him out of tell him you're leaving.
Messing w/your older daughter is a HUGE red flag. You will have to worry about 'saving' your older daughters once you are out. They are adults, and all you can do is wait for them to figure it all out. In the meantime, you and your 7 yr old need to get out NOW.
Please make sure you erase all history and cookies from all devices (phone, tablet & computer) so he doesn't know you've come to this site. If you have to, ask your parents to call the women's shelter on your behalf. Ask them to tell them all that you've said here and be sure to include his threats to take your daughter away from you.
If you can't leave right away, gather whatever evidence you can. If you can SAFELY find any bank account numbers, old tax returns, asset statements or pay stubs, etc., scan, copy or photograph them and send them to your family. You do NOT want this getting back to him. As he WILL escalate and that will make contacting your family very difficult.
After you know they received everything, delete everything you just did. If you can't get the copies to your parents, put them on a flash drive and put them in a safe deposit box in your name only. Also, start stashing any money you can someplace where he would never think to look.
Whatever you do, make sure who ever you trust is not going to be in contact w/him. It is imperative that he not know what you're planning.
